S Beam
Share more and share it faster with S Beam. From photos to documents, large video files to maps,
you can share almost anything instantly with one touch, simply by placing your devices back-to-back.
S Beam uses your phone's NFC (Near Field Communication) feature to send, or "beam", content to
other NFC devices.
S Beam works in the background. Use the sharing options from your favorite apps to select content
to share via S Beam. For example, you can beam pictures or videos from Gallery, or songs from
Music player. Just bring the devices together (typically back to back), and then tap the screen.
Turn S Beam On or Off
When S Beam is turned On, you can send or receive data by touching your phone to another NFC-
capable device.

Nearby Devices
Share files with devices using DLNA (Digital Living Network Alliance) standards, over Wi-Fi.
To use Nearby devices, you must connect to the same Wi-Fi network as the devices you wish to
share with, and the other devices must support DLNA.
Note: Use care when enabling file sharing. When enabled, other devices can access data on your
phone.
